Hello all, I'm David from Pennsylvania. I just joined because these forums can be helpful and I'm not really a coin collector like I was when I was younger but am slowly finding some interest in it again. I am a silver stacker and favor the Canadian maples. The ASE premiums are just too high although I have a few graded ones. One in particular, I went and bought a PCGS MS70 2020 P emergency issue silver eagle and I noticed today after it came in the mail that the nose looks to be doubled. At first I thought it was a part of a star but when I compared it to my other eagles I noticed there are no stars near her nose. I'll have to unload pics once I figure out how.
I haven't belonged to any forums for over 20 years.
I have never heard of or seen double die ASE. Is this something other members have knowledge in? Thank you for the membership. - David

Welcome and, yes, pics are needed but I will go out on a limb and say it's most likely Machine Doubling which is frequently seen in modern issues and usually does not add any value other than being a curiosity.
